One last stupid question for the next few days:

When trying to telnet to the FreeBSD box, I get a
Connecting to 10.0.0.1......Could not open a connection to host: Connect
failed

I can ping the machine without a problem, so I know there is connectivity.
What do I need to do to be able to telnet into the system from the LAN?

> >> ex: WARNING: board's EEPROM is configured for IRQ 0, using 5
> >> ex0: <Intel PRO/10+ or compatible adapter> at port 0x200-0x20f iomem
0xcc000-0xcffff irq 5 on isa0
> >> ex0: PnP config, 16-bit bus, board id 0xfff, stepping 0xf
> >> ex0: Ethernet address ff:ff:ff:ff:ff:ff
> >
> >Not good. Have you tried disabling PnP in your BIOS?
>
> if I can recall correctly, that board can be either PnP or jumperless.
> download the dos program from intel, and set the board to where you
> want it.  PnP is great for PCI, but sucks for ISA, imho.
>
> I've done this with all my isa network cards and never had a problem
> with freebsd or any other OS for that matter.
